Middletown, Indian River and Brandywine earned the top seeds when the three DIAA Football Tournament brackets were released Nov. 9.
The Cavaliers (7-3) are the defending champions in Class 3A. They will open the postseason at home against eighth-seeded St. Georges at 7 p.m. Nov. 14.
The Indians were promoted to Class 2A after winning the Class 1A championship last season, and Indian River has made a seamless transition with a 10-0 record. IR will take a 19-game winning streak into its playoff opener, at home against eighth-seeded Odessa at 7 p.m. Nov. 14.
